In this profoundly touching episode of "What I Wish I Knew After Pregnancy Loss," our compassionate host, Sharna, welcomes Erika, who courageously shares her heart-rending yet ultimately hopeful journey through infertility, IVF treatments, and pregnancy loss.
For the first time, Erika recounts her path to motherhood, highlighting the critical role of spiritual growth, the healing power of love, and the significance of fostering connections and support during some of life’s most difficult trials.

In This Episode, You'll Discover:

  • Erika's intimate and poignant narrative of facing pregnancy loss and navigating the complexities of IVF.
  • The vital importance of nurturing a supportive space for oneself, alongside spiritual and emotional readiness in the journey towards welcoming new life.
  • Key insights into the process of healing from pregnancy loss, with an emphasis on the power of connection, love, and empathy.
  • Valuable advice for parents on the importance of being present with their children, fostering a joyful environment of play and learning.
  • Erika's reflections on the significance of forming early bonds with unborn children and tips on managing life and expectations after experiencing loss.
